The Importance of Ride-Sharing App Updates

Ride-sharing apps, like Uber and Lyft, have revolutionized urban transportation by offering convenient and affordable alternatives to traditional taxis and public transit. These apps must constantly evolve to address changing user needs, technological advancements, and regulatory requirements. Updates are essential for:

  • Enhancing functionality: Introducing new features and improving existing ones to provide a better user experience.
  • Fixing bugs: Addressing software issues that can hinder app performance or cause crashes.
  • Improving security: Protecting user data and transactions from cyber threats.
  • Ensuring compatibility: Making sure the app works seamlessly on the latest operating systems and devices.
  • Adapting to regulations: Complying with new laws and regulations that govern ride-sharing services.

The Pros of Ride-Sharing App Updates

1. Enhanced User Experience

Improved Interface and Usability

One of the primary benefits of app updates is the enhancement of the user interface (UI) and user experience (UX). Updates often include redesigns that make the app more intuitive and user-friendly. For example, simplifying the booking process, improving navigation, or adding features like in-app chat can significantly enhance the overall user experience.

Personalization and Customization

Updates can introduce personalized features that cater to individual user preferences. This includes personalized ride recommendations, preferred driver options, and customized payment methods. Such features make the app more engaging and convenient for users.

2. New and Improved Features

Advanced Navigation and Routing

Updates can integrate advanced navigation and routing algorithms, ensuring that drivers take the most efficient routes and avoid traffic congestion. This not only improves ride times but also enhances overall satisfaction for both riders and drivers.

Safety Enhancements

Safety is a critical concern in ride-sharing services. App updates can introduce safety features such as real-time tracking, emergency buttons, and driver background checks. These features provide users with peace of mind and contribute to a safer ride-sharing environment.

Integration with Other Services

Updates can enable integration with other services such as public transit, bike-sharing, and food delivery. This creates a seamless experience for users who rely on multiple modes of transportation and services in their daily lives.

3. Bug Fixes and Performance Improvements

Stability and Reliability

Frequent updates help identify and fix bugs that can cause the app to crash or malfunction. This leads to a more stable and reliable app, reducing user frustration and improving overall satisfaction.

Faster Load Times

Performance improvements often focus on reducing load times and improving app responsiveness. A faster app enhances the user experience, particularly in a fast-paced environment where users expect quick and efficient service.

4. Security Enhancements

Data Protection

Updates often include security patches that protect user data from cyber threats. This is especially important in ride-sharing apps, which handle sensitive information such as payment details and location data.

Fraud Prevention

Security updates can introduce measures to prevent fraud and unauthorized access. This includes enhanced authentication methods, encryption, and real-time monitoring of suspicious activities.

5. Compliance with Regulations

Adapting to New Laws

The ride-sharing industry is subject to various regulations that can change over time. Updates ensure that the app complies with new laws and regulations, avoiding legal issues and potential fines.

Ensuring Fair Pricing

Regulatory updates may include changes to pricing algorithms to ensure fair and transparent pricing for users. This helps maintain trust and satisfaction among the user base.

The Cons of Ride-Sharing App Updates

1. Potential for Bugs and Glitches

Introduction of New Issues

While updates aim to fix existing bugs, they can sometimes introduce new ones. This can result from changes in the codebase, new feature integration, or compatibility issues. Users may experience crashes, slowdowns, or unexpected behavior after an update.

Impact on User Experience

Bugs and glitches can significantly impact the user experience, leading to frustration and dissatisfaction. If critical functionalities are affected, it can disrupt the service and lead to negative reviews.

2. Increased Data Consumption

Larger Update Files

App updates can be substantial in size, especially if they include major changes or new features. Downloading large updates can consume significant amounts of data, which may be a concern for users with limited data plans.

Background Data Usage

Updates can also increase background data usage if the app requires frequent updates or data synchronization. This can lead to higher data costs for users.

3. Compatibility Issues

Older Devices

New updates may not be compatible with older devices or operating systems. This can result in the app not functioning correctly or at all on these devices, forcing users to upgrade their hardware or software.

Fragmentation

The diversity of devices and OS versions in the market can lead to fragmentation issues. Ensuring compatibility across all platforms requires extensive testing, and even then, some issues may slip through.

4. Learning Curve

Adapting to New Features

Significant updates that introduce new features or redesign the UI can require users to adapt to changes. This learning curve can be frustrating, particularly for users who are accustomed to the previous version of the app.

User Resistance

Users may resist updates if they perceive them as unnecessary or if they disrupt their usual workflow. Negative reactions can lead to poor adoption rates and potential backlash.

5. Potential Downtime

Service Interruptions

The process of updating the app can sometimes result in downtime or temporary unavailability. This can inconvenience users who rely on the app for their daily commute or other essential services.

Data Loss

In rare cases, updates can cause data loss or corruption. This can be particularly problematic if users lose important ride history, payment information, or other personal data.

Case Studies: Successful Ride-Sharing App Updates

Uber: Introducing Safety Features

Uber has consistently updated its app to enhance safety for both riders and drivers. In 2018, Uber introduced a series of safety features, including an in-app emergency button, real-time ride tracking, and driver background checks. These updates addressed growing concerns about rider safety and significantly improved user trust and satisfaction.

Lyft: Enhancing User Experience

Lyft has focused on enhancing the user experience through updates that streamline the booking process and provide personalized recommendations. In 2020, Lyft introduced a redesigned app interface that simplified ride selection and improved navigation. This update resulted in higher user engagement and positive feedback.

Grab: Expanding Services

Grab, a leading ride-sharing platform in Southeast Asia, has expanded its services through regular updates. By integrating food delivery, package delivery, and digital payment services into its app, Grab has created a one-stop solution for users. This diversification has increased user engagement and loyalty.

Best Practices for Users: Navigating App Updates

Keep Your App Updated

Regularly updating your ride-sharing app ensures that you benefit from the latest features, performance improvements, and security enhancements. Enable automatic updates to stay current with minimal effort.

Review Update Notes

Before updating the app, review the update notes provided by the developer. This information can help you understand what changes and improvements have been made, and what to expect after the update.

Backup Important Data

Before performing a major update, consider backing up important data, such as ride history and payment information. This precaution can help prevent data loss in the unlikely event of an update issue.

Provide Feedback

Your feedback is valuable to developers. If you encounter issues or have suggestions for improvement, use the app’s feedback feature to communicate with the development team. Your input can help shape future updates.

Manage Data Usage

Monitor and manage your app’s data usage, particularly if you have a limited data plan. Adjust settings to reduce background data usage and download updates over Wi-Fi whenever possible.
